当前位置:首页>AI提示库 >

Stable Diffusion本地部署教程

发布时间:2025-08-04源自:融质(上海)科技有限公司作者:融质科技编辑部

随着人工智能技术的飞速发展,深度学习模型在图像处理、自然语言处理等领域的应用越来越广泛。其中,生成对抗网络(GAN)中的“生成器”部分,即Stable Diffusion,因其出色的性能和广泛的应用前景而备受关注。本文将详细介绍如何在本地环境中部署Stable Diffusion模型,以实现高效的图像生成和处理。

一、理解Stable Diffusion

Stable Diffusion是一种基于生成对抗网络的图像生成模型,它能够根据输入的数据生成高质量的图像。与传统的GAN模型相比,Stable Diffusion具有更高的稳定性和更好的生成效果。

二、部署步骤

  1. 环境准备
  • 确保你的计算机硬件配置能够满足Stable Diffusion模型的运行需求。
  • 安装必要的软件包,如PyTorch、TensorFlow等。
  • 下载Stable Diffusion模型文件,并确保其与你的操作系统兼容。
  1. 导入模型
  • 使用PyTorch或TensorFlow等深度学习框架,导入Stable Diffusion模型。
  • 设置模型的参数,如学习率、优化器等。
  • 定义损失函数和评估指标,如准确率、生成图像的质量等。
  1. 训练模型
  • 准备训练数据,包括输入数据和对应的输出标签。
  • 设置训练过程,如迭代次数、批处理大小等。
  • 启动训练过程,让模型逐渐学会生成高质量的图像。
  1. 测试模型
  • 使用测试数据对模型进行评估,检查生成图像的效果是否符合预期。
  • 根据评估结果调整模型参数,优化模型性能。
  1. 部署模型
  • 将训练好的模型部署到生产环境中,以便实际应用。
  • 编写相应的应用程序接口(API),让用户能够调用模型进行图像生成。
  • 提供用户支持服务,解答用户在使用过程中遇到的问题。

三、注意事项

在部署Stable Diffusion模型时,需要注意以下几点:

  1. 确保数据质量:输入数据的质量直接影响到生成图像的效果。因此,需要对输入数据进行清洗和预处理,确保数据的质量和一致性。

  2. 避免过拟合:在训练过程中,需要合理控制模型的复杂度和规模,避免过拟合现象的发生。可以通过调整学习率、增加正则化项等方法来防止过拟合。

  3. 关注细节:在生成图像的过程中,需要关注细节问题,如图像的清晰度、颜色准确性等。可以通过调整模型参数、优化算法等方法来提高生成图像的细节表现。

  4. 持续优化:随着技术的不断发展和用户需求的变化,需要不断优化模型的性能和功能。可以通过收集用户反馈、分析生成图像的效果等方式来发现问题并进行改进。

通过以上步骤和注意事项,我们可以在本地环境中成功部署Stable Diffusion模型,实现高效、准确的图像生成和处理。这将为人工智能领域的发展和应用带来新的机遇和挑战。

欢迎分享转载→ https://www.shrzkj.com.cn/aiprompts/120468.html

Copyright © 2025 融质(上海)科技有限公司 All Rights Reserved.沪ICP备2024065424号-2XML地图